My 4th great Grandma. Daughter of Reverend Charles Anderson & Lucy Stokes. I believe her father was a preacher at Beasley Creek Church in Mason Co., KY. He donated the land for it.

Paternal grandparents: James Anderson & Elizabeth Ligon
Maternal grandparents: Sherard Young Stokes & his wife Elizabeth.

Elizabeth Anderson married Obediah Ragsdale probably about 1795.
Children:
1) Berryman (1795-1842) m Jun 30, 1815 to Sarah Chapman (1799-1864).

2) Gabriel (1799-1850/1860) m Oct 5, 1826 to Lubenia Campbell (1804-unknown).

3) Rebecca Allen (1807-1862) m Feb 14, 1828 to Willis Calvert (1794-1849).

4) Susan A. (1807-1830) never married.

5) Charles Anderson (1808-1892) m Apr 19, 1827 to Casandra Crisler (1810-1905).

In 1800 Grandpa purchased 124 acres on Lick Run in Mason County. By 1810 they were in Bracken County then moved to Boone County in 1818. About 1820 Grandma became a widow.
